What is the primary characteristic of a depletion-mode FET?
Step 1: Understand what a FET (Field Effect Transistor) is. It is a type of transistor used to control electrical signals.
Step 2: Learn about depletion-mode FETs. These are a specific type of FET.
Step 3: Know that a depletion-mode FET is normally on. This means it allows current to flow even when no voltage is applied to the gate.
Step 4: Realize that to turn off a depletion-mode FET, you need to apply a negative voltage to the gate.
Step 5: Conclude that the primary characteristic of a depletion-mode FET is that it conducts current without a gate voltage and needs a negative voltage to stop conducting.
